# A verifying agent in your live worktree measures your uncommitted work
## Problem
You dispatch a subagent to verify a merge: *"run the four suites and the validator against
`main`, report the numbers."* You point it at the worktree you are working in, because that
is where the venv is symlinked and the tooling is set up.
Then you keep working — editing, staging, committing, merging PRs.
**The agent's gate run measures the branch plus whatever is in your working tree at that
instant.** There is no clobber, no error, and nothing looks wrong: the suites really execute,
the numbers it reports are real numbers, and it prints them with a commit SHA next to them.
They are simply counts of a tree that exists only on your disk and will never be merged.
The report then becomes the session's evidence — pasted into a PR body, a handoff, a tracker
card — as "verified green at `<sha>`".
## Why this is worse than the clobber cases
The sibling failures in this collection are loud once you look:
- `dispatched-bash-agent-git-checkout-clobbers-uncommitted-edit` — your edit vanishes.
- `concurrent-session-checkout-clobbers-shared-worktree` — the branch changes under you.
- `subagent-read-stale-worktree-needs-head-pin` — the agent's cited lines contradict yours.
Here **nothing contradicts anything**. The only signal is a total that does not reconcile
with the same command run at a different moment — and totals move for legitimate reasons all
day in a repo with parallel sessions, so the delta reads as normal churn.
## Context / trigger conditions
- You dispatched an agent to "verify", "run the gates", "confirm main is green", or "check
the suite counts", and its prompt named a worktree path you are also using.
- An agent's reported total disagrees with your own run of the same command, with no merge
in between to explain it.
- An agent mentions, in passing, that the working tree was modified with files it did not
write, or that `HEAD` moved mid-run.
- A `git status` in the agent's transcript is non-empty when you expected a clean tree.
- You are about to publish "verified at `<sha>`" using numbers gathered while you had
unstaged edits.
## Worked example (2026-08-05)
A session merging a run of PRs dispatched a verification agent into its own worktree while it
carried on drafting. The agent later reported:
> `CLAUDE.md` in the worktree showed as modified with 65 lines I did not write, and shortly
> after the worktree's detached HEAD advanced on its own. My first gate run was silently
> measuring main *plus* an uncommitted foreign change.
It caught this **only** because a validator count moved `150 → 152` between two runs it
expected to match — and it recovered by checking the commit out in a throwaway worktree and
re-measuring there. Had the counts happened to be stable across those two moments, the
contaminated numbers would have shipped as the session's verification evidence.
## The fix
**Give a verifying agent a checkout nobody else writes to.** Put it in the agent's prompt, not
in your own head:
```bash
# in the AGENT's prompt — its own tree, pinned to an explicit commit
git worktree add --detach /tmp/verify-<slug> <sha-or-origin/main>
cd /tmp/verify-<slug>
ln -sfn /path/to/repo/.venv .venv # or whatever the tooling needs
# ... run the gates here ...
git worktree remove --force /tmp/verify-<slug>
```
Then either of these, as the situation allows:
- **Pin the commit.** Pass the SHA you want verified and have the agent assert it:
`git rev-parse HEAD` must equal it before any suite runs.
- **Or finish first.** Commit and push everything, then dispatch. A verifying agent and an
author working the same tree is the collision; sequencing removes it.
**Require the agent to prove the tree was clean.** Its report must include `git status --short`
output (empty) and `git rev-parse HEAD` alongside every count. A number without those two is
not evidence about a branch — it is evidence about a moment on somebody's disk.
## Detection after the fact
If you suspect a contaminated run, you do not need to reason about it — re-measure:
```bash
git worktree add --detach /tmp/recheck <sha>
cd /tmp/recheck && <the gate commands>
git worktree remove --force /tmp/recheck
```
If the numbers differ from the agent's, the agent's were of your working tree. Republish the
clean ones and say which report was superseded — a corrected number in a PR body is cheap; a
wrong one quoted onward by a tracker card is not.
